1. Cagliari: Private or Small Group Fishing Trip Experience

Set sail from the new harbor in Teulada and cruise towards the beautiful capes of Cala Zafferano, Capo Teulada and Capo Malfatano on the southern coast of Sardinia. Take in panoramic views of the impressive cliffs and golden sand beaches along the way. Cool down with a swim in the sea and get the chance to learn how to fish from the experts. Practice throwing fishing nets to reap the rewards of what you have learned, and keep a look out for the friendly dolphins that come up close as they swim in the crystal clear water. Learn more about the other marine life that live in the deep sea of Sardinia. Enjoy a tasty lunch of freshly caught fish cooked on the boat before you sail back to port at the end of the afternoon.

2. Alghero: Gulf of Alghero Fishing Boat Trip with Fresh Lunch

In Alghero, a beautiful town in the north west of Sardinia, you can participate in a fun and informative day of fishing. Our fisherman and experienced skipper will accompany you in a family-friendly experience with the practical demonstration of fishing with pots, in the picturesque setting of the Gulf of Alghero, to discover its marine fauna. There will also be a stop to dive in the crystal clear waters and snorkel in the Marine Protected Area of Capo Caccia and, At lunch time, will be served the catch of the day prepared directly on board to immerse you even more in the tradition and culture of the place.  Itinerary: - Navigation to the Marine Protected Area of Capo Caccia - Fishing demonstration lasting about 45 minutes in the Gulf of Alghero, where you can try your hand guided by our expert fisherman on board - Stop directly from the boat in the Protected Marine Area and lunch on board - Reentry The itinerary may vary depending on the weather conditions and the decisions of the captain. The lunch served on board will be based on the local catch of the day, according to availability, and will include: a first course (with crab sauce, lobster, octopus or fish sauce), second course (mixed frying, octopus with potatoes, octopus salad or octopus agliata), water, wine, coffee and digestive.

3. Sant'Antioco: Private fishing excursion by boat

Experience an exciting fishing adventure suitable for both beginners and experienced anglers. Join us on a comfortable dinghy from Sant'Antioco port, accommodating a maximum group of four. Our skilled skipper will tailor the fishing techniques, stops, and target species to your preferences. Engage in thrilling battles with Mediterranean predators like dentex, amberjacks, tuna, and groupers, using trolling, bolentino, and drifting methods. Don't miss this unforgettable tour, whether you're a seasoned enthusiast or new to the exhilarating world of water sports! The itinerary involves sailing south or north, depending on the marine weather conditions of the day: - Sailing south: island of Sant'Antioco/Gulf of Palmas with possible stops in the coves of Porto Sciusciau or Maladroxia or - Navigation northwards: Gulf of Leone/San Pietro with possible stops in the area of Cala Vinagra More stops are foreseen and will be agreed according to the weather and the period, the experience of the participants and their requests or needs. Fiching Techniques: The first part of the day will be devoted to searching for live bait such as mackerel, horse mackerel, sardines and squid. Next, we will search for and catch the perfect fish, adapting the itinerary and stops according to the weather conditions of the day. The techniques that can be practised during the experience are as follows: - Tuna drifting - Light tuna drifting - Light paragut and blackfin tuna drifting - Coastal boating - Squid fishing - Tuna trolling The best equipment available on the market from the world's leading sport fishing equipment manufacturers will be used. The sought-after prey are the Mediterranean's largest predators: snappers, amberjacks, tuna, groupers, and the difficulty is relative to the type of fishing that will be chosen, agreeing this after booking with our expert fisherman at the telephone number on the booking voucher. Boat: Joker Barracuda dinghy, very safe boat - Length: 5.8 m - Width: 2.54 m - Maximum capacity: 8 passengers plus skipper - External freshwater shower - Climbing ladder - Awning - Safety equipment and life jackets for all participants
